Why Bo-Katan may never die in Star Wars

Katee Sackhoff, who plays Bo-Katan Kryze in Star Wars, has confirmed the character is still alive and will likely appear in future stories. Speaking at Fan Expo Vancouver on February 14th, Sackhoff stated definitively that Bo-Katan is “not dead” and “ain’t going anywhere.”

Katee Sackhoff believes her character, Bo-Katan, is likely to remain a part of the Star Wars universe for a long time. She joked that the character’s design is based on Dave Filoni’s wife, Anne Convery, meaning she has ‘job security forever.’ Sackhoff previously shared on her podcast that both the character’s name – inspired by Convery’s cat, Boogie – and appearance were modeled after Convery, not herself.

Katee Sackhoff first voiced the character Bo-Katan in the animated series Star Wars: The Clone Wars in 2008. She continued to play the role in Star Wars Rebels and later brought Bo-Katan to life in the live-action series The Mandalorian.

Bo-Katan appeared in ten episodes of The Mandalorian, becoming a main character starting with Season 3. Most recently, she reactivated the Great Forge and started rebuilding Mandalore, leaving her story with possibilities for the future.

Since Season 4 of The Mandalorian has been put on hold until the new show, The Mandalorian & Grogu, it’s unclear when Katee Sackhoff will reprise her role. There’s a possibility Bo-Katan will appear in the second season of Ahsoka, given that both shows take place during the same time period and share connected storylines.

Katee Sackhoff described the emotional experience of first wearing the Bo-Katan armor in live-action, recalling that she and Dave Filoni both teared up when it happened.
